Where is Hoodsport? 

Located along the Hood Canal, right where U.S. Route 101 meets State Route 119, Hoodsport is a picturesque town with stunning scenery. Known as the gateway to the Staircase area of the Olympic National Park, you’ll be within minutes of renowned spots for hiking or scuba diving. For big-city activities, head to downtown Olympia, just 50 miles away, or to Seattle, about 100 miles away.

Things to do near your Hoodsport rental

Head to Lake Cushman Private Park is a family-friendly venue with a large playground, a shared basketball court, and a large gazebo perfect for picnics. Launch canoes and explore the waterway, or fish in Lake Cushman any time of year. Visit the Mt. Ellinor Lower Trailhead for a nearby hike. Lake Cushman Golf Course provides nine holes and a practice green. Downtown Hoodsport has a selection of restaurants and specialty shops worth checking out.
